Madison County, Iowa, United States

Overview

Madison County, Iowa, is a tranquil rural area famous for its picturesque covered bridges, farmland landscapes, and small-town charm. The welcoming communities, historic sites, and festivals provide an authentic slice of Midwestern life.

Best Time to Visit

September-October for fall foliage and covered bridge festival

Local Tips

Rent a car for easier access to rural sites and bridges; local shops often close early on weekends.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ping 15-20% is standard in restaurants; dress is generally casual but respectful for local events; greetings are friendly and informal.

Safety Warnings

Madison County is very safe overall; watch out for deer on rural roads, and be cautious during ice or snow in winter months.

Hidden Gems

Hogback Covered Bridge (less visited), Cedar Lake for fishing and hiking, and the annual Winterset Art Center exhibits.
